Rex Infernus keeps one side quest off the main path. A purple rift can open on a Sanctuary wall, pull your Operator into a private talk with Ava (the Entity), and drop you back outside with extra loot.

Quick answer: Play as one of the eight dedicated Operators, turn on Pack-a-Punch at the Nexus Forge, wait for a Deathspinner Max Ammo round, then use the single purple rift that appears on a wall in one Sanctuary.


Dedicated Operators for the Rex Infernus rift

The rift only answers eight dedicated Operators. Those names are Richtofen, Dempsey, Nikolai, Takeo, Maya, Weaver, Grey, and Carver.

Any other Operator leaves the walls quiet. Swap before the match if you want the conversation and the loot that follows it.


Purple rift trigger conditions

Load into Rex Infernus as one of the eight dedicated Operators. The rift is locked to that roster, so the rest of the setup fails if the wrong character is in play.
Activate Pack-a-Punch at the Nexus Forge. The rift will not appear while that machine is still dark.
Stay in the match until a Deathspinner round begins, the spider wave that also throws a Max Ammo. That is the only window the rift uses.
Sweep all four Sanctuaries during that Max Ammo wave. The rift sits on a wall in only one temple, and it can appear anywhere inside that building.
Interact with the purple rift. You are moved into a room with Ava, the conversation plays, and you return to the map when it ends.

Purple rift locations in each Sanctuary

Only one Sanctuary holds the rift on a given Deathspinner Max Ammo round. Treat every wall as fair game. A missed corner is enough to make the whole wave look empty.

Nyxara’s Sanctuary is a clean first pass. Walk the main chamber and the rooms off it, and watch for a glowing purple mark on stone, including the stretch beside a striped gate.

In the same temple the rift can also read as a bright breach instead of a small crystal. Face the wall at standing height and wait for the interact prompt.

If Nyxara is empty, move into Veytharion’s Sanctuary. The halls are wrecked, so slow down and scan the ruined corridors instead of sprinting the objective path.

On those cracked walls, look for a purple breach you can aim at and use. It sits in the stone, not on a pedestal.

Dravakar’s Sanctuary hides the same object on heavier masonry. The glow may sit high or low, and it can look more like a crystal set into the wall than an open tear.

Finish the lap in Caltheris’s Sanctuary. Cover the entrance, the side rooms, and every wall you can reach. If all four temples stay dark, Pack-a-Punch is still off, the Operator is wrong, or the round is not a Deathspinner Max Ammo.


Entity conversation and loot

Using the rift teleports you into a room with Ava. The talk is unique to the Operator you brought in. When the scene ends, you spawn back outside the rift.

Loot is waiting at that exit. Mystery Perks are part of the drop, and a Ray Gun can appear with them. Weaver and the rest of the eight leave the same way, standing at the sealed tear with the new items on the floor.

You know it worked when the cutscene finishes and that pile is on the ground. A silent wall with no interact prompt means the trigger never fired.


All Operator conversations with Ava

There are 16 talks in total. Each of the eight Operators has two. The lines below are the substance of those scenes, not a transcript.

OperatorDialogue
Richtofen #1Ava and Dravakar caution him against hardening into the same kind of jailer he is fighting.
Richtofen #2Ava states his origin sits in Samantha Maxis’s memory.
Dempsey #1He asks her age. Centuries in captivity have erased the number.
Dempsey #2She affirms that he and the other three persist as leftovers of Maxis’s recollection.
Nikolai #1He presses her on why the Shadowsmiths cannot put the Warden down themselves.
Nikolai #2He tests the idea of a repeating timeline. She rejects a simple time-loop label.
Takeo #1He treats the Dark Aether trip as a gift that let him face what he left behind.
Takeo #2He talks about shielding people who cannot save themselves and making cruel men pay.
Maya #1She asks for a branch of reality where her brother survived, and a way into it.
Maya #2Ava confirms the Twins are Maxis memories given form.
Weaver #1Ava praises his command.
Weaver #2She makes his coming death a condition for saving Maxis’s child.
Grey #1She is promised three years with a newborn named Ava, enough to close the wound Maxis opened.
Grey #2She is told the Warden wants a rewritten world built as his perfect union.
Carver #1Nyxara reaches Ava again by speaking through him.
Carver #2He is given five years after the Warden falls, then a final sacrifice.

Miss the window and the wall goes quiet. The next Deathspinner Max Ammo is the next chance to find the rift, hear the other half of an Operator’s talk, and collect another drop.
